Description

This book has been created to provided targeted practice exercises for the two language skills most requested by teachers and most troublesome for many students. These are understanding similes and metaphors, and recognizing and explaining the meaning of idioms and adages.

The student will focus on these key language skills by completing sets of focused exercises that increase from easy, to moderate, and then to advanced. This leveled and focused approach will introduce students at a comfortable level and then build on the skills so that students reach and then exceed grade level expectations.

STAAR Test Prep

While the aim of this book is mainly to develop and enhance language skills, the skills learned will also improve performance on the STAAR Reading test and the STAAR Writing test. The STAAR Reading test includes questions on vocabulary and on sensory language, including similes and metaphors. The strong understanding developed from this book will improve student performance on these questions, as well as increase general reading comprehension skills.

The STAAR Writing test includes two composition sections. The language skills developed in this book will encourage stronger word choices, allow students to convey ideas more precisely, produce more engaging writing, and help students produce writing that demonstrates a more advanced level of vocabulary and writing skill. These improvements will increase the scores received for the compositions. The stronger understanding of words and language will also improve student performance on the revision and editing sections of the STAAR Writing test.
